In July 2008, NCARB launched ARE 4.0. This version of the Architectural Registration Exam updates and improves the current format by combining graphic and multiple-choice content in each division of the exam. ARE 4.0 emphasizes the problem-solving skills architects regularly use in day-to-day practice.
